To be eligible for graduation with a Bachelor Degree from a California State University, students must complete a maximum of 39 semester units of general education
coursework. Taft College will certify completion of up to 39 lower division, general education units for students based on the pattern outlined below.

U.S. HISTORY, CONSTITUTION AND AMERICAN IDEALS (This is not a General
Education Breadth Pattern requirement; however, these courses should be
completed prior to transferring to any CSU campus)
Complete two (2) courses, one from group 1 and one from group 2
Group 1: HIST 2231, 2232 Group 2: POSC 1501
